Entrepreneur Of The Year
Maryland Capital Enterprises annual Entrepreneur of the Year Award is named in honor of one of our very own local business owners that truly embodies that great entrepreneurial spirit! Palmer Gillis, a Salisbury native, has spent the last 37 years building his construction company into the one of the largest general contracting firms on Maryland’s Eastern Shore. Along the way, he continues to give back through public service, including as an elected member of the Salisbury City Council and as a board member for numerous charitable causes and foundations. He has been a leading voice in trying to make his community a better place.
The winner of MCE’s Palmer Gillis Entrepreneur of the Year Award will be someone who has taken the risk of starting their own business, has created jobs, and has a business plan for the future. They have that fighting spirit that refuses to give up. They may be sleep-deprived and worn down, but they are ready to take on the world. The business owner must reside in one of the following counties: Wicomico, Worcester, Somerset ,Kent, Queen Anne’s, Caroline, Talbot or Dorchester counties of the Eastern Shore. Eligibility Criteria
- Nominees must be a small business owner or majority partner involved in day-to-day operations of the business.
- Business must be located in Wicomico, Worcester, Somerset, Kent, Queen Anne’s, Caroline, Talbot, or Dorchester counties.
- The company must employ 100 employees or less
- The business must have been established locally for at least two (2) years.
- Must be a for-profit business
- Businesses must be in good standing with the State of Maryland.

Maryland Capital Enterprises is pleased to announce that Windmill Creek Vineyard & Winery has been named the 2022 MCE Palmer Gillis Entrepreneur of the Year! Windmill Creek is the 11th recipient of this award, which began in 2012. On October 13th at the 11th Annual MCE Palmer Gillis Entrepreneur of the Year Awards Banquet Mr. Maurice Ames, Executive Director at Maryland Capital Enterprises & Palmer Gillis, CEO Gillis-Gilkerson made the big announcement & presentations, which also included our two newest awards that began in 2021: The Workforce Development Award , presented to Bernard Johnson of Johnson’s Cleaning Service ( Cambridge, MD) & The Innovator Award, presented to Sophia Christian of Nori Sushi Bar & Grill & Sophia’s Italian Restaurant (Ocean City, MD).

Our Past Winners
2021 Dr. Amy Heger
The Night Watch Childcare Center
2020 Anthony Darby
Peninsula Wellness/Peninsula Alternative Health
2019 Lacey Coleman
Coastal Comfort Heating & Air Conditioning
2018 Jeremy Norton
Roadie Joe’s Bar & Grill
2017 Jaime Windon
Lyon Distilling, LLC
2016 Johnny Shockley
Hooper’s Island Oyster Aquaculture
2015 Chris Eccleston
Delmarva Veteran Builders
2014 Dr. Kerry Palakanis
Crisfield Clinic
2013 Ryan Miller
The Deli, Last Call Liquors, R. Miller Properties and The Monkey Barrel
2012 Pete Roskovich
Adam’s the Place for Ribs & Black Diamond Catering
